As if Newcastle United fans haven’t suffered enough.

It has been a long window for the Toon faithful, with little or no transfer activity and no movement on a new contract for Rafael Benitez.

There had been hope this week that a top-class addition or two might be close amid a blizzard of reports that the club are working on deals to sign the likes of Alassane Plea, Kenedy, Andros Townsend and company.

Sky Sports claimed in a transfer update on their website on Thursday afternoon that the north-east giants “remain in talks” to land Plea.

The broadcaster are as reliable as any outlet around but a report emanating from Germany by the excellent Kicker magazine must be taken extremely seriously.

The outlet claim Plea is in fact close to completing a transfer to Borussia Mochengladbach.

It is said the Nice striker has reached an agreement in principle to join the Bundesliga outfit after settling personal terms and the two clubs are now close to sealing a fee and the terms of payment.

It is a major blow to Newcastle fans, who are desperate for their club to sign a centre-forward worthy of the name.

Plea scored 21 goals from 49 matches in all competitions for Nice last season and has emerged as a target for a number of Premier League clubs looking to land a regular scorer from a major European league.

It will not be long before the finger of blame is pointed by the Toon faith in their tens of thousands at Mike Ashley, the hugely unpopular owner whose cautious transfer market approach infuriates supporters.

The failure to land Plea will be regarded by many as Peak Ashley, another decent player for whom the groundwork has been laid but who has bitten the transfer dust.
